Output 37596efd629271300fb08fbf112e0ea64077396fec4a6687a5e4b9ed7d42f096:17

value
2553236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d777a5f38bfce28eceb019e8de093741611e058 OP_EQUAL
address
32vDqWrj8wiSq4njFXH5wfnF5j5v6WeAgc
transaction
37596efd629271300fb08fbf112e0ea64077396fec4a6687a5e4b9ed7d42f096
spent
true